Forms of the verb 'taberu' and 'kuki yomene'
This chapter covers different forms and contexts of the verb 'taberu' meaning 'to eat' in Japanese, including present simple, present negative, past positive, and past negative forms. It also explores the casual form, te form, and the use of 'tabete' as a request or order. Additionally, it discusses 'kuki yomene', meaning 'not being able to read the air'.
